Output 51bd27c65e9a78245d25b0cf6b994effcf3dbd59206f9e5e509ab376f55fc646:0

value
104593836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1608b2aa35ce326a0473e05d0d369d14da75778 OP_EQUAL
address
3HruBTyuiFg1vUcXgk1jJ2t3VUqsbZrpLV
transaction
51bd27c65e9a78245d25b0cf6b994effcf3dbd59206f9e5e509ab376f55fc646
spent
true